An on-duty police detective was carjacked Tuesday evening in south Baltimore, Commissioner Michael Harrison said.

It happened around 6:15 p.m. when police said the detective was carjacked by three armed suspects, WBAL reports.

"At some point, our detective pulled out his weapon and discharged his weapon, but it is unknown if any of the individuals were struck by gunfire or any injuries at this point," Harrison said.

Harrison said the suspects sped off in the officer's unmarked car then crashed and fled the scene. he says they've apprehended two and are still looking for a third suspect.

The officer was not injured. He wasn't in uniform but was wearing a polo shirt, embroidered with a badge and had identification around his neck. Harrison said he was at a local business at the time.
